The Pantheon desktop environment is built on top of the GNOME software base, i.e. GTK, GDK, Cairo, GLib, (including GObject and GIO), GVfs, Vala and Tracker. Bryan Lunduke of Network World wrote that the Pantheon desktop environment, elementary OS's centerpiece, was among the best of 2016.[6] Pantheon is also being released as an optional work-in-progress desktop environment in GeckoLinux. In addition to its x86 installer, Elementary offers various experimental builds that run on ARM devices such as the Pinebook Pro and Raspberry Pi 4.[7]
